使用java/camel从响应中安全删除http头
我需要从我发送给第三方的响应中删除以下标题
$WSIS:
$WSPR: HTTP/1.1
$WSRA:
$WSRH:
$WSSC: http
$WSSN:
$WSSP:
Authorization:
用Java或camel从响应中删除HTTP头的最佳方法是什么?我们使用的是WAS8.5服务器
你可以在下面搜索框中键入要查询的问题!
我需要从我发送给第三方的响应中删除以下标题
$WSIS:
$WSPR: HTTP/1.1
$WSRA:
$WSRH:
$WSSC: http
$WSSN:
$WSSP:
Authorization:
用Java或camel从响应中删除HTTP头的最佳方法是什么?我们使用的是WAS8.5服务器
# 1 楼答案
您可以使用removeHeader/removeHeader。前者采用一种可以使用通配符模式删除的模式,例如
removeHeader("$W*")
# 2 楼答案
这些头是由WebSphere插件添加的,而不是由Camel添加的。使用removeHeader似乎是唯一的解决方案。对我来说也是如此。。。这肯定是一个很好的解决办法,但绝对不是一个解决方案